Instructions
Specimen: Serum Volume: 5 mL Minimum Volume: 1.5 mL (Note: This volume does not allow for repeat testing.) Container: Gel-barrier tube or red-top tube


Transport Temperature
Specimen: Serum Volume: 5 mL Minimum Volume: 1.5 mL (Note: This volume does not allow for repeat testing.) Container: Gel-barrier tube or red-top tube Collection: Transfer specimen to plastic transport tube before freezing. Serum must be separated from cells within one hour of venipuncture. Submit serum in a plastic transport tube. Storage Instructions: Freeze. Stable at room temperature for three days or refrigerated for 14 days. Stable when frozen for 3.79 years. Freeze/thaw cycles: stable x2. Causes for rejection: Plasma specimen received; gross hemolysis
